How to Use the MARSHINE Φ1160 Large Diameter Universal Stringing Block

The MARSHINE Φ1160Large Diameter Universal Stringing Block is a critical tool in power line construction and maintenance, designed to simplify cable installation while ensuring safety and efficiency. Main features of MARSHINE Φ1160Large Diameter Universal Stringing Block


Large Diameter Design: Φ1160 model accommodates high-tension cables and conductors, reducing friction and wear during installation.


Universal Compatibility: Suitable for a variety of cable diameters and types, including aluminum, copper and composite conductors.


Durable Construction: The structure is made of high-strength alloy steel with an anti-corrosion coating to ensure service life in harsh environments.


Step-by-step guide to using the MARSHINE Φ1160 Large Diameter Universal Stringing Block.


1. Pre-installation preparation


Inspect the pulley block: Check for cracks, deformation or rust. Make sure the pulley rotates smoothly and the locking device is working properly.


Choose the mounting point: Select a sturdy structure such as a transmission tower or pole rated to withstand the load capacity of the pulley block.


Gather tools: Include winches, tensioners, and rigging hardware (e.g., shackles, slings) for a secure connection.



2. Install the threading pulley block


Attach to the structure: Secure the pulley block with a rated shackle or bolts. Align it to match the expected path of the cable to minimize angular stress.


Verify stability: Confirm that the mounting structure of MARSHINE Φ1160Large Diameter Universal Stringing Block can withstand dynamic loads during cable pulling.


3. Threading the wire


Feed the wire: Thread the cable through the pulley sheave, making sure it is centered to avoid uneven wear.


Attach the pulling equipment: Use a winch or tensioner to apply controlled force. Avoid sudden jerk to prevent cable damage.


4. Perform pulling operations


Monitor tension: Use a dynamometer to ensure tension remains within the rated capacity of the pulley.


Adjust alignment: If the cable is off track, pause and readjust the pulley or cable path.



5. Post-operation inspection


Clean pulleys: Remove debris and lubricate pulleys to maintain performance.


Store properly: Store the MARSHINE Φ1160Large Diameter Universal Stringing Block in a dry environment to prevent corrosion.


Safety Considerations

Load Limits: Never exceed the manufacturer’s specified load capacity to avoid structural failure.


Personal Protective Equipment (PPE): Workers should wear gloves, helmets, and safety belts during installation.


Regular Maintenance: Schedule inspections for wear and tear, especially after high-stress projects.
